Chronically Sexy: heavy machinery (or, good vibes even with chronic hand pain)

Welcome to the inaugural Chronically Sexy, our new column in which the fabulous and knowledgable Searah Deysach answers your questions about sex and sensuality for ChronicBabes. As always, we remind you that our articles are meant to help you start your own research and should not be considered medical advice. Do your homework, Babes!

This month, a reader asks:

"I have chronic hand pain (from repetitive stress injury), and I've been told not to use heavy machinery for any amount of time because the vibrations could exacerbate my pain. But I love to use vibrators, and the results actually help me relax - and manage my pain better. Is there any chance I'm hurting my hands with the vibrations? Maybe it's just an urban myth, and I feel a little silly asking, but better safe than sorry, right?"

Searah answers:

While there are some pretty freakin' big vibrators out there, I am sure none of them qualify as "heavy machinery"... at least not in the way your doc was speaking of. Of all the research I have done on the subject of vibrators I have never come across anything to indicate that they can harm your hand, even if you have chronic pain.

Personally, I have suffered chronic hand and wrist pain for the last 10+ years and have found vibrators to be nothing but a joy. And I use them A LOT. The vibrations that most personal vibrators transmit are relatively mild in comparison to almost any other kind of machinery out there. Some, like the Hitachi Magic Wand, are super-powerful and relatively heavy (1 lb. 9 oz.), but most vibes weigh just a few ounces, and I even find that the mild vibrations relax my sometimes-cramped hand.

If you have pain in your hand/wrist from repetitive stress (or whatever) you may find that sexually pleasuring yourself or you partner can actually make the pain worse (it can be a lot of work to whack someone off). Vibrators are an amazing way to make stimulation of your good parts much easier on your body and there are some vibes out there that are great for people who have hand issues.

Some fit right on your finger tip so you don't even have to hold on to anything. (For example, the Fukuoko, the Fiona or the Ida.) They also make vibes that you can wear on your hips so the vibe is positioned right over your clitoris, again, leaving you nothing to worry about holding on to. (We like the Passion Flower or the Teacher's Pet.) Some are ergonomically shaped so reaching your sweet spot is easier and you don't have to grip quite as hard. (Check out the Perfect Touch or Tula.)

Of course, if you find that after using your vibe, you hand hurts more, then maybe you have to re-examine the type of vibe you are using, and maybe even try a different one. We should also realize that it is natural to really tense up our bodies right before orgasm, and this can exasperate any pain that we have in our hands (if we are using our hands).

Pay attention to what is happening in your body when you climax and remember to breath and relax into your orgasm. Sex should be something that brings you pleasure, not pain (unless that is your game I guess) and as long as you are enjoying it and it feels good, go for it!
